2 Hazards identification
Hazard designation: T Toxic F Highly flammable Information pertaining to particular dangers for man and environment: The product has to be labelled due to the calculation procedure of the "General Classification guideline for preparations of the EU" in the latest valid version. R 11 Highly flammable. R 23/24/25 Toxic by inhalation, in contact with skin and if swallowed. R 39/23/24/25 Toxic: danger of very serious irreversible effects through inhalation, in contact with skin and if swallowed. R 41 Risk of serious damage to eyes. R 48/22 Harmful: danger of serious damage to health by prolonged exposure if swallowed. Classification system: The classification is in line with current EC lists. It is expanded, however, by information from technical literature and by information furnished by supplier companies.

4 First aid measures


General information: Instantly remove any clothing soiled by the product. After inhalation: Supply fresh air or oxygen; call for doctor. After skin contact: Instantly wash with water and soap and rinse thoroughly. Get medical attentions if irritation develops and persists. After eye contact: Rinse opened eye for at least 15 minutes under running water. Then consult doctor. After swallowing: Rinse out mouth and then drink plenty of water. If swallowed, do not induce vomiting. Get medical attentions.

5 Fire fighting measures


Suitable extinguishing agents: CO2, extinguishing powder or water spray. Fight larger fires with water spray or alcohol-resistant foam. For safety reasons unsuitable extinguishing agents: Water with a full water jet. Special hazards caused by the material, its products of combustion or resulting gases: Formation of toxic gases is possible during heating or in case of fire. Nitrogen oxides (NOx) Sulphur dioxide (SO2) Carbon monoxide (CO) Protective equipment: Put on breathing apparatus. Additional information Cool endangered containers with water spray jet.

6 Accidental release measures


Person-related safety precautions: Wear protective equipment. Keep unprotected persons away. Measures for environmental protection: Do not allow to enter drainage system, surface or ground water. Measures for cleaning/collecting: Absorb with liquid-binding non combustible material (e.g. sand). Send for recovery or disposal in suitable containers. Dispose of contaminated material as waste according to Section 13. Ensure adequate ventilation. Additional information: See Section 7 for information on safe handling. See Section 8 for information on personal protection equipment. See Section 13 for information on disposal.

7 Handling and storage


Handling Information for safe handling: Ensure good ventilation/exhaustion at the workplace. Open and handle container with care. Information about protection against explosions and fires: Keep ignition sources away - Do not smoke. Protect against electrostatic charges. Keep breathing equipment ready. Storage Requirements to be met by storerooms and containers: Store in cool location. Further information about storage conditions: Keep container tightly sealed. Store in cool, dry conditions in well sealed containers. *

8 Exposure controls and personal protection


Additional information about design of technical systems: No further data; see Section 7. Components with limit values that require monitoring at the workplace: 67-56-1 methanol WEL (Great Britain) Short-term value: 333 mg/m, 250 ppm Long-term value: 266 mg/m, 200 ppm Sk IOELV (EU) Long-term value: 260 mg/m, 200 ppm Skin 7553-56-2 iodine WEL (Great Britain) Short-term value: 1.1 mg/m, 0.1 ppm Personal protective equipment General protective and hygienic measures: Keep away from foodstuffs, beverages and food. Take off immediately all contaminated clothing. Wash hands during breaks and at the end of the work. Store protective clothing separately. Avoid contact with the eyes and skin. Breathing equipment: In case of brief exposure or low pollution use breathing filter apparatus. In case of intensive or longer exposure use breathing apparatus that is independent of circulating air. Protection of hands: The glove material has to be impermeable and resistant to the product/ the substance/ the preparation. Due to missing tests no recommendation to the glove material can be given for the product/ the preparation/ the chemical mixture. Material of gloves: The selection of the suitable gloves does not only depend on the material, but also on further marks of quality and varies from manufacturer to manufacturer. As the product is a preparation of several substances, the resistance of the glove material can not be calculated in advance and has therefore to be checked prior to the application. Penetration time of glove material: The exact break through time has to be found out by the manufacturer of the protective gloves and has to be observed. Eye protection: Tightly sealed safety glasses. Body protection: Light weight protective clothing.

9 Physical and chemical properties:


General Information Form: Colour: Odour: Change in condition Melting point/Melting range: Boiling point/Boiling range: Flash point: Self-inflammability: Danger of explosion: Density at 20C: Fluid Yellowish Recognizable Not determined Not determined 13.5C Product is not selfigniting. Product is not explosive. However, formation of explosive air/steam mixtures is possible. 0.957 g/cm

Solubility in / Miscibility with Water: Fully miscible Viscosity: dynamic at 14C: 2.16 mPas

10 Stability and reactivity


Thermal decomposition / conditions to be avoided: Stable (at room temperature) for 5 years Dangerous reactions: No dangerous reactions known. Dangerous products of decomposition: No dangerous decomposition products known.

11 Toxicological information
Acute toxicity: LD/LC50 values that are relevant for classification: 67-56-1 methanol Oral LD50 5628 mg/kg (rat) LDLo 143 mg/kg (man) Dermal LD50 20000 mg/kg (rbt) 111-42-2 2,2'-Iminodiethanol Oral LD50 1600 mg/kg (rat) Dermal LD50 12200 mg/kg (rbt) Primary irritant effect: on the skin: Irritant to skin and mucous membranes. on the eye: Irritant effect. Sensitization: No sensitizing effect known. Additional toxicological information: The product shows the following dangers according to the calculation method of the General EC Classification Guidelines for Preparations as issued in the latest version: Toxic Irritant USA TSCA (Toxic Substances Control Act) 67-56-1 methanol 108-32-7 Propylene carbonate 111-42-2 2,2'-Iminodiethanol

12 Ecological information:
Ecotoxical effects: Aquatic toxicity: 67-56-1 methanol EC50/48h >10000 mg/l (Daphnia magna) LC50/96h 29400 mg/l (Pimephales promelas) General notes: Water hazard class 1 (German Regulation) (Self-assessment): low hazard to waters. Do not allow product to reach underground or surface water or sewage system.

13 Disposal considerations
Product Recommendation: Must not be disposed of together with household garbage. Do not allow product to reach sewage system. Remove in accordance with the local official recommendations. European waste catalogue 16 05 06 laboratory chemicals, consisting of or containing dangerous substances, including mixtures of laboratory chemicals Uncleaned packagings: Recommended cleaning agent: Water, if necessary with cleaning agent. *

14 Transport information
Land transport ADR/RID ADR/RID Class: Hazard Index Number: Substance Index Number: Packaging group: Label Designation of goods: 3 Flammable liquids. 336 1230 II 3+6.1 1230 METHANOL, mixture

Maritime transport IMDG: IMDG Class: 3 UN Number: 1230 Label 3+6.1 Packaging group: II EMS Number: F-E,S-D Marine pollutant: No Correct technical name: METHANOL, mixture Air transport ICAO-TI and IATA-DGR: ICAO/IATA Class: 3 UN/ID Number: 1230 Label 3+6.1 Packaging group: II Correct technical name: METHANOL, mixture
